Comparison of Mean Glandular Dose between Full-Field Digital Mammography and Digital Breast Tomosynthesis

Abstract: Early detection of breast cancer is diagnosed using mammography, the gold standard in breast screening. However, its increased use also provokes radiation-induced breast malignancy. Thus, monitoring and regulating the mean glandular dose (MGD) is essential. The purpose of this study was to determine MGD for full-field digital mammography (FFDM) and digital breast tomosynthesis (DBT) in the radiology department of a single centre. We also analysed the exposure factors as a function of breast thickness. A total … Show more

“…A study by Gennaro et al (2018) concluded that the average increase of DBT dose compared to FFDM was 38%, and a range between 0 % and 75% [ 7 ]. Although another study by Teoh et al (2021) found dose in DBT was slightly higher than in FFDM, in CC projection, AGD of FFDM showed somewhat higher than DBT [3.37 mGy vs. 1.86 mGy] and vice versa in the MLO view [1.37 mGy vs. 1.88 mGy] [ 28 ]. The high dose observed in DBT compared to FFDM is primarily due to the technology of DBT.…”

“…Recent advancements in technology have introduced reconstruction algorithms that directly generate 2D synthetic mammography (2DSM) images from the DBT dataset, which are comparable in diagnostic performance to FFDM and do not require additional radiation exposure [18,19]. Therefore, it is crucial to evaluate radiation doses and risks associated with mammographic examinations to determine the benefits of such exams [20]. It is also essential to analyze recall rates and the relationship between various mammographic parameters, such as compressed breast thickness (CBT), exposure factors, and target/filter combination of DBT and DM, to optimise the radiation dose.…”
